Injection-locked FP-LD used as a low-cost colorless ONU received great attention in WDM-PON research filed. In this paper, considering the relationship between the excess intensity noise and the bandwidth of the spectrum-sliced ASE, the experimental comparison of the output signal quality of the FP-LD injected with different bandwidths seed light was given.
